The study of the Mittag-Leffler function and its various generalizations has become a very popular topic in mathematics and its applications. In the present paper we prove the following estimate for the q-Mittag-Leffler function: (1)/(1+Γq(1-α)z)≤ eα,1(-z;q)≤\frac11+Γq(α+1)-1z. for all 0 < α< 1 and z>0. Moreover, we apply it to investigate the solvability results for direct and inverse problems for time-fractional pseudo-parabolic equations in quantum calculus for a large class of positive operators with discrete spectrum.
